Don't know this would be helpful for cMBP users or not, but I found unchecking the "Put hard disks to sleep when possible" function in Energy Saver will avoid the machine going into "deep sleep", especially for cMBP running on SSD.
After unchecking this my cMBP wakes from sleep in just seconds of time, no matter it has slept for 8 hours or so.

Quote:
sudo pmset -a standbydelay <time in seconds> Example to only go into standby mode after 10 hours: sudo pmset -a standbydelay 36000
